Photos












About 21 Mountain Ave, Unit 3
Nice Studio Apartment in a Beautifully Well Maintained Victorian Style Multifamily. Located Within an Easy Walking Distance to Popular Downtown Somerville's Restaurants, Shops, Events and Train Station with NYC Service! Featuring: Open Floor Plan, Cathedral Ceiling, Ceiling Fan / Light Combination, New Heating System, New 14,000 BTU Window AC Unit w/ Timer, Nicely Updated Kitchen and Bath with White Cabinetry and Matching Appliances / Fixtures, Private Entrance and Off Street Parking.Water, Sewer and Trash Removal Included, Close to All Major Transportation, Parks and Recreation, Shopping ( 5 Minute Drive to Bridgewater Commons Mall ), and Restaurants. Must See! *No Pets or No Smoking Allowed, 3rd Floor Apartment with No Laundry Hook-Up, Portable Washing Machines Prohibited* Square footage is approximate - tenant must verify. ***CREDIT CHECK - Good Credit Scores, Proof of Qualifying Income, and Legal Form of Picture I.D. Required*** Property Plus Licensed Real Estate Broker
21 Mountain Ave, Unit 3 is located in the Downtown Somerville Neighborhood and 08876 Zip code of Somerville, NJ.
Property Contact Info
Floorplan Pricing and Availability
21 Mountain Ave, Unit 3 offers Studio apartments starting from $1,500 and having 400 sq ft. Here is the current pricing and availability:
New! Interactive Property Map
Studio
$1,500
21 Mountain Ave, Unit 3
Studio, 1 Bath, 400 sq ft $2,250 depositAvailable Jul 1Availability Details
Price Availability Date Unit Sq Ft Deposit $1,500 July 1, 2025 3 400 $2,250 Unit 3 Amenities and Features
Features
- Air Conditioning
- Ceiling Fans
- Heating
- Smoke Free
Kitchen
- Kitchen
Unit 3 Rent and Fees
Price
- $1,500
Deposit
- $2,250 deposit
Apartment Unit: 3Apartment Model: 3 - 21 Mountain Ave$1,500Studio, 1 Bath, 400 sq ftAvailable July 1, 2025
Schedule a Tour
Property Information
- 3 Units
You are leaving ApartmentHomeLiving.com…
Lease Terms
- 12 Month Lease
Parking Fees & Info
Parking Surface
- Surface Lot
Features and Amenities
Interior Features
- Heating
- Ceiling Fans
- Air Conditioning
- Smoke Free
Kitchen Amenities
- Kitchen
Pet Policy
- No Pets Allowed

Map
- Shopping
- Colleges
- Schools
- Grocery
- Medical
- Transportation

Map
What Are Walk Score®, Transit Score®, and Bike Score® Ratings?
- Walk Score® measures the walkability of any address.
- Transit Score® measures access to public transit.
- Bike Score® measures the bikeability of any address.
Frequently Asked Questions about 21 Mountain Ave, Unit 3
Where is 21 Mountain Ave, Unit 3 located?
21 Mountain Ave, Unit 3 is located at 21 Mountain Ave near the Downtown Somerville area of Somerville, NJ
What is the current rent range at 21 Mountain Ave, Unit 3?
Studio at 21 Mountain Ave, Unit 3 is $1,500. Call today for more info!
Are pets allowed?
Call us today to find out our pet policy and if we allow pets
New Jersey Social Services Information
Statewide service is free, confidential, multilingual and always open. Three easy ways to reach Social Services in NJ: Dial 2-1-1; text your zip code to 898-211; or chat at https://www.nj211.org
Points of Interest
Time and distance from 21 Mountain Ave, Unit 3.
Big Box and Retail
Colleges and Universities
Groceries
Hospitals
Shopping Centers
21 Mountain Ave, Unit 3 has 5 shopping centers within 0.5 miles.
Transit Stations
Nearby Neighborhoods
Nearby Apartments
Rental Price Ranges in the Area
Bedroom | Average Rent | Cheapest Rent | Highest Rent |
---|---|---|---|
Somerville Studio Apartments | $2,206 | $1,710 | $2,470 |
Somerville 1 Bedroom Apartments | $2,530 | $1,475 | $5,324 |
Somerville 2 Bedroom Apartments | $3,104 | $1,711 | $6,400 |
Somerville 3 Bedroom Apartments | $4,092 | $2,649 | $4,845 |
Somerville 4 Bedroom Apartments | $4,605 | $4,000 | $5,245 |
Browse Top Apartments in Somerville
- See Somerville Apartments for Rent
- See Somerville Homes for Rent
- See Somerville Condos for Rent
- See Somerville Townhomes for Rent
- Cheap Somerville Apartments
By Price
By Community Type
- Somerville Apartments for Rent by Owner
- Somerville Apartments with Rent Specials
- Somerville Top Rated Apartments
- Somerville Corporate Apartments
- Somerville Furnished Apartments
- Somerville Gated Apartments
- Somerville Loft Apartments
- New Somerville Apartments
- Somerville Senior Apartments
- Somerville Short-term Apartments
- Somerville Apartments with Utilities Included